GOMEZ V. PEREZ
409 U.S. 535 (1973)
NATURE OF THE CASE: This was a dispute over child support to an illegitimate child.
FACTS: P filed a suit to get support for her minor child. The Texas court recognized that
D was the father and that the child needed the support and maintenance of her father but
then ruled that because the child was illegitimate there was no legal obligation for D to
support her and P would take nothing. The court of appeals affirmed.
